... Read moreFreestyle dance is a fantastic way to express creativity and individuality on the dance floor. One of the key aspects is to feel the music deeply and allow your body to move naturally without overthinking each step. In my experience, practicing regularly in front of a mirror helps build confidence and improves your ability to transition smoothly between moves. When freestyle dancing, it’s also important to develop a personal style. You don’t have to stick to one set of moves; instead, combine various elements from different dance genres, such as hip-hop and street dance, to create something uniquely yours.
